#a38bf0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a38bf0 is composed of 63.9% red, 54.5%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.1%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 254.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 74.3%. #a38bf0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4717e1.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#a38bf0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a38bf0 has RGB values of R:163, G:139,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 10718192.

Shades and Tints of #a38bf0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020106 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a38bf0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bdbdbe is the less saturated color, while #9e81fa is the most saturated one.
